Barleyford Drive is in Stoke-On-Trent and in Stoke-On-Trent district. ST3 5TF is located in the Sandford Hill elect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Stoke-on-Trent South.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Barleyford Drive was 247.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 34.0% lower than the Fenton East average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Barleyford Drive has the 19th highest crime rate of 69 local areas in Fenton East and the 91st highest crime rate of 844 local areas in Stoke-on-Trent .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 75.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-52.7%.

ST3 5TF area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in ST3 5TF area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 31%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
